  • Patent number: 10596122
    Abstract: Amorphous magnesium-substituted calcium, phosphate compositions and their medical uses are described, in particular for use in delivering cargo materials, such as cargo molecules or cargo nanoparticles contained in pores of the amorphous magnesium-substituted calcium phosphate to cells of the immune system, for example as therapeutic approaches for the treatment of inflammatory bowel diseases, and in particular Crohn's disease, autoimmune diseases, allergy and for therapeutic vaccination.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 5, 2014
    Date of Patent: March 24, 2020
    Assignee: Medical Research Council
    Inventors: Jonathan Joseph Powell, Nuno Jorge Rodriguez Faria, Laetitia Pele, Rachel Hewitt, Emma Thomas-McKay
